Understanding Conflicting Offers

Conflicting offers occur when two or more buyers submit proposals that differ significantly in price, terms, or conditions. These offers can create confusion and pressure for the seller, especially if they are unsure which to accept. Recognizing the differences and potential advantages of each offer is the first step toward making a strategic choice.

Strategies for Handling Conflicting Offers

1. Review Each Offer Carefully

Analyze the details of each proposal, including the price, contingencies, closing timeline, and any special conditions. Consider not only the monetary value but also the reliability and flexibility of each buyer.

2. Communicate Transparently

Maintain open communication with all interested parties. Let buyers know if you have multiple offers and ask for their best and final proposals. Transparency can encourage competitive bidding and better terms.

3. Consider Holding a Backup or Backup Offers

If you receive an offer that is strong but not quite what you want, consider requesting a backup offer. This ensures you have options if the primary deal falls through.

Always act ethically and within legal boundaries when handling multiple offers. Avoid any actions that could be perceived as manipulative or unfair, as this can lead to legal issues or damage your reputation.
